    Default Keyhole Cichlids (Cleithracara maronii)

    This are really cool little cichlids . They only get about 4 inches and are usually not a problem with plants. They are considered gentle peaceful cichlids. They arent suitable for a discus tank as they prefer cooler water, though I did manage to keep some in low 80s and they seemed ok..its probably not good for them.

    I picked up a group of 8 from Tristan's Tropicals yesterday. They are housed in a 40 gal breeder as a grow out.. they are small but already very personable little guys. They tend to be shy but in a group of 8 they feel comfortable.

    Default Re: Keyhole Cichlids (Cleithracara maronii)

    I had those not long ago. The last one died of old age this last spring. I did keep them with discus in a 125 gal. tank, temp around 83f. They are one of many of my favorite SA cichlids.
